Council’s research paper/scientific article entitled “Comparative standardization study for determination of reserpine in Rauwolfia serpentina homoeopathic mother tinctures manufactured by different pharmaceutical industries using HPTLC as a check for quality control”, published in Indian Journal of Research in Homoeopathy 2017; 11:109-17 received 2nd Prize of  Dr. P. D. Sethi National Memorial Award for the best research article published in the field of Pharmaceutical Analysis amongst 110 research articles submitted for the year 2017. The Indian Journal of Research in Homoeopathy (IJRH) is a peer reviewed journal published by Central Council for Research in Homoeopathy, Ministry of AYUSH, and Govt. of India.

It has been awarded to the Drug Standardization team consisting of Dr.Binit Kumar Dwivedi, R.O(Chemistry), Mr.Manoj Kumar SRF(Botany), Dr.Echur Natarajan Sundaram, R.O (Endocrinology), Dr. Bhopal Singh Arya, Incharge, DDPRCRI,Noida, Dr.Anil Khurana, DDG, CCRH and Raj K.Manchanda, D.G.CCRH. This award carries a reward of Rs.12, 500/- (jointly) and a certificate to each author.

Dr. P. D.  Sethi’s Annual Award is instituted by KONGPOSH Publication, publishers of the Pharma Review and Indian Pharma Reference Guide in honour of Dr.P.D Sethi, an Eminent Pharma Analyst and being given for the best research paper published in the field of Pharmaceutical analysis every year.
